Problem: the 2-space inline keyword pattern matched preamble lines like "The possible keywords" where "The" was detected as a keyword. Solution: require an uppercase letter after the 2 spaces, matching real inline definitions (Tunnel Request, SetEnv Directly) but not preamble text where the next word is lowercase.
